H8643
Hebrew
Original Word
תְּרוּעָהTransliteration
tᵉrûwʻâh
Pronunciation
ter-oo-aw'
Definition
from רוּעַ; clamor, i.e. acclamation of joy or a battle-cry; especially clangorof trumpets, as an alarum; alarm, blow(-ing) (of, the) (trumpets), joy, jubile, loud noise, rejoicing, shout(-ing), (high, joyful) sound(-ing).
